WASHINGTON -- Wall Street honcho Ken Langone took President Obama to the woodshed yesterday for acting "unpresidential" and "petulant" by pitting rich and poor Americans against one another during the bruising battle over the debt limit.
"He's not bringing us together. He's willfully dividing us. He's petulant," said Langone, a former director of the New York Stock Exchange and founder of Home Depot.
"Ronald Reagan would never go into the Oval Office without his jacket on -- that's how much he revered the presidency,"
